The Texas Tech University Health Sciences Center is being honored for its contributions to rural health care, education, and research. Established in 1969, it has graduated over 42,000 health care professionals and is composed of six distinguished schools. The institution has been a leader in addressing rural health care challenges across Texas, expanding access to care through innovative research and community-based services. It has also pioneered the use of telehealth and other technologies to reach remote areas. The resolution expresses high regard by the Texas House of Representatives.
